    Why the Michigan Marijuana Tax Block Appeal Matters: Background & Context

    Michigan’s legal cannabis market is no stranger to change. Since voters approved adult-use marijuana in 2018, the state has fostered one of the Midwest’s most robust cannabis economies, routinely cited by MJBizDaily as a growth powerhouse. But with great sales come great regulatory headaches. Lawmakers, citing both needed infrastructure repairs and adult-use program sustainability, decided to introduce an additional 24% excise tax on marijuana product purchases. This landed with a thud for industry advocates and many local businesses, who argue Michigan is already overtaxed compared to national averages (Michigan CRA). For consumers, higher taxes could mean higher prices. Recent debates over the Michigan marijuana tax block appeal have drawn battle lines between supporting essential state programs and protecting a still-fragile legal market from a thriving, untaxed illicit sector.

    Key Developments & Issues in the Michigan Marijuana Tax Block Appeal

    The pivotal move came on December 23, 2025, when a coalition called Michigan Cannabis Freedom challenged the new 24% marijuana excise tax by filing for an emergency block at the state appellate court. Their legal argument? The tax is both excessive and unfairly targets legitimate cannabis businesses that have already weathered exhaustive oversight. The coalition’s plea cites how the tax is slated to take effect at the beginning of 2026, just as small businesses are struggling to compete with illegal sellers who pay zero in taxes and compliance fees. State regulators counter that the new levy is crucial for funding regulatory oversight, law enforcement training, and community investments earmarked for regions hit hardest by past marijuana prohibition. If the appellate court sides with the coalition, as seen in other federal marijuana law changes, it could halt the tax rollout in its tracks, delaying or even stopping one of the largest state-level cannabis tax changes in recent history.

    Expert Analysis & Pro-Cannabis Counterpoints

    So what’s really at stake with the Michigan marijuana tax block appeal? For business owners, it’s survival 101. According to Ganjapreneur insiders, “Michigan’s cultivators and retailers operate on razor-thin margins. An extra 24% excise tax could tip many over the edge, hurting both employment and local investment.” It’s also a fairness issue, as few other industries face so many stacked costs. Nationally, excessive taxation has been linked to stagnation or decline in legal sales, as reported in Leafly’s California coverage. These observations point to how high taxes can inadvertently fuel black markets and deter established businesses, which has prompted a renewed evaluation of local cannabis policy in other regions. The court’s focus now: balancing fiscal needs with long-term viability for the legal cannabis industry. Across states, regulators have seen how high taxes can inadvertently fuel black markets and deter established businesses, making this appeal more than a Michigan problem, it’s a bellwether for cannabis tax debates everywhere.
